Con-Nichiwa is an annual anime convention held during November at the DoubleTree by Hilton Hotel Tucson – Reid Park in Tucson, Arizona.
Programming
The convention typically offers a cosplay cafe, cosplay parade, J-Fashion show, maid cafe, masquerade, panels, and vendors.
History
The convention moved from the Holiday Inn Palo Verde to the Tucson Convention Center in 2014 due to growth. Con-Nichiwa shared the Tucson Convention Center with Bernie Sanders and Donald Trump 2016 election campaign events. Con-Nichiwa 2020 was moved from June to November due to the COVID-19 pandemic, but was later cancelled.
